Mississippi Legal Requirements for Divorce


Explanation of Chart and More Information on Requirements for Divorce

Code Section93-5-1, et seq.
Residency RequirementsOne party actual, bona fide resident for 6 months before suit.
Waiting PeriodFinal decree entered immediately but may be revoked at any time by granting court upon joint request of parties.
'No Fault' Grounds for DivorceIrreconcilable differences (only if uncontested).
Defenses to a Divorce FilingRecrimination not absolute bar; collusion (adultery).
Other Grounds for DivorceAdultery; cruelty or violence; willful desertion; drug/alcohol addiction; natural impotency; incurable insanity; pregnant at time of marriage; conviction of crime; prior marriage undissolved; in line of consanguinity.
